Requirements:

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Be at least 21 years of age.
  • Hold a high school diploma or equivalent, including a General Equivalency Diploma (GED), High School Equivalency Test (HiSET), or Test Assessing Secondary Completion (TASC).
  • Have 3 college credits in management or supervision from an accredited college or university. This requirement may also be met by:
    • At least 2 years of experience in a supervisory or management position; or
    • A written plan to complete 3 credits in management or supervision through an accredited college or university.
  • Have a minimum of 1,500 hours of experience working with children in a licensed childcare program or public/private elementary school.

Additional Education and Experience:

Candidates must also meet at least one of the following qualifications:

  • A minimum of an associate's degree or higher from an accredited college or university, with coursework related to early childhood education or a related field
  • An additional 3,000 hours of experience working with children in a licensed childcare program or public/private elementary school, along with a current Child Development Associate (CDA) credential in center-based programs awarded by the Council for Professional Recognition
  • Current certification in early childhood education, elementary education, or special education issued by the Department of Education
  • Certification from a teacher preparation program accredited by the Montessori Accreditation Council for Teacher Education (MACTE) in Infant and Toddler, Early Childhood, or Elementary I, together with 60 college credits from an accredited college or university
  • Documentation of 60 college credits, including at least 24 credits in related coursework and a minimum of 3 credits in each of the following core knowledge areas:
    1. Children with special needs
    2. Child growth and development
    3. Curriculum for early childhood education
